The median home in Anderson, Indiana is valued at $129,321, up 1.9% year over year. Typical monthly rent is $1,029, producing a price-to-rent ratio of 10.5x — below the national average of 18x. Anderson is part of the Indianapolis-Carmel-Anderson, IN metropolitan area, which CrashWatch tracks daily with real-time stress scores and crash risk analysis.
